Trademark workshops provide an invaluable platform for entrepreneurs and brand managers to deepen their understanding of trademark law. These workshops are designed to demystify the registration process, offering practical guidance on how to conduct trademark searches, file applications, and respond to office actions from trademark offices. The hands-on nature of these sessions often involves case studies and interactive discussions, allowing participants to engage with industry experts and gain insights that can directly impact their branding strategies.
Moreover, trademark workshops often highlight the importance of proactive brand management. Participants learn how to monitor their trademarks effectively, ensuring that their brand remains distinct and protected against infringement. This proactive approach not only safeguards a business’s intellectual property but also enhances its market position, enabling companies to build stronger relationships with their customers and stakeholders.
